To effectively trim and shape shrubs into specific shapes, use sharp and clean pruning shears to make precise cuts. Start by trimming any overgrown branches and then gradually shape the shrub by cutting it into the desired form. Remember to step back periodically to assess the shape and make adjustments as needed.

How can I effectively remove shrubs while ensuring that their roots are completely eliminated?

To effectively remove shrubs and ensure their roots are completely eliminated, you can use a combination of techniques such as digging out the shrub and its roots, cutting back the shrub and applying herbicides to the remaining stump to prevent regrowth. It is important to be thorough in removing all parts of the shrub to prevent it from growing back.


How can I effectively protect my shrubs during the winter season?

To effectively protect your shrubs during the winter season, you can use methods such as mulching, wrapping them with burlap, or creating windbreaks. These measures help insulate the shrubs from harsh weather conditions and prevent damage.

How can I effectively remove dead shrubs from my garden?

To effectively remove dead shrubs from your garden, start by cutting the shrub close to the ground using pruning shears or a saw. Then, dig around the base of the shrub to loosen the roots and carefully pull the shrub out of the ground. Dispose of the dead shrub properly, either by composting or disposing of it in green waste. Make sure to wear gloves and protective clothing while removing the shrub to avoid any potential injuries.

How should I prune boxwood shrubs?

To prune boxwood shrubs, use sharp shears to trim back any overgrown or dead branches. Shape the shrub by cutting back to a bud or branch junction. Avoid cutting into old wood as it may not regrow. Prune in early spring before new growth appears for best results.

Why are my evergreen shrubs turning yellow?

Evergreen shrubs may turn yellow due to various reasons such as nutrient deficiencies, overwatering, poor soil drainage, or pests. It is important to identify the specific cause in order to address the issue and restore the health of the shrubs.
